In Canada, it was faster and less paperwork. I planned my last trip giving me just enough time to take the oath, wait 2-3 days (time it takes for CIC to send your information to Passports Canada) and then request express pickup. Took my test on a Wednesday and had my passport next Tuesday. I had to pay the express pickup fee, but I came back with my Canadian passport.

Just a quick update to let you know that I sent the address request change on October 2018, on March 2019 I took the test and told the officer that I requested the change of the address to Spain but that it wasn't changed on ECAS. She wasn't very surprised. Well, I received an email yesterday about my application and I have my oath ceremony in 1 month. So there hasn't been any issue with moving abroad. I still got my citizenship and didn't have to fill the RQ.

So, as long as you do everything right and don't lie, there shouldn't be any issues.

I personally know 2 people from work who applied around the end of 2017 (after C-6) and moved out of Canada, one moved just a couple of months after submission, the other one moved after over a year. Both got their test and oath invite while living outside of Canada, and both have become citizens without any RQ
